Diaspora : Le cri de détresse des Sénégalais du Canada, menacés d'expulsion à cause de leurs passeports !
The Senegalese community in Canada is sounding the alarm. In a press release issued by Dieylani on behalf of several compatriots, they denounce a critical situation regarding passport issuance. For several months, they have been facing "abnormally long delays, often without any clear communication or follow-up on their applications."
This administrative paralysis is not without consequences. The delays directly impact the immigration status of students and workers. The press release highlights "concerning human consequences," including the blocking of immigration procedures, the inability to renew essential documents, and a "real risk of losing legal status in Canada."
The document also relays poignant testimonies from members of the diaspora. “Because of the delay, I almost lost my status,” confides MD, while another user, AL, laments that “the services are unreachable.” Faced with what they describe as a “near-total lack of communication,” Senegalese people in Canada say they are ready to take action. Several members affirm that they are “ready to contribute concretely, including financially, to improve passport production capacity locally.”
The demands are clear: an immediate reduction in processing times, improved communication, and increased consular resources. A petition has also been launched to directly appeal to the Senegalese authorities regarding this "consular distress" which is jeopardizing the stability of many Senegalese citizens.
